5. LABORATORY TEST
$.1 Hardness: The surface hardness of Single point headed Shovel was recorded as under
Sr. Hardness (HB)
Conformity to IS |
No As per IS: 3342-1998, As observed
T |The shovel and sweep shall have
Does not Conforms
hardness in the range of 350 to 450 HB | Shovel=299.67
(sce I$:1500) when tested upto a] Sweep=117
distance of 50mm from the cutting
edge
5.2 Chemical composition: - A piece of shovel was analyzed for its chemical Composition
The results of chemical analysis are given as under: -
‘AS per ‘Composition Remarks
Constituents | IS: 6023-1970 (% of weight) | as observed
(% of weight)
Carbon (C) 0.70-0.80 0.6104 ‘Conforms
Manganese (Mn) 0.50-0.80 0.7988 Does not Conforms |
Sulphur (S) (0.050 Max 0.0130 Conforms:
Phosphorous (P) (0.040 Max 0.011 Conforms:

6.1 Rate of Work
© The rate of work in medium soil was recorded as 0.554 — 0.629 ha/h at the forward
speed of 3.68 — 4.021 kmph respectively.
‘© The time required to cover one hectare area was recorded as 1.589 ~ 1.80 hour
6.2. Quality of work
© The depth of tilled was recorded as 12.76 ~ 14.38 cm.
+ The field efficiency was recorded as 76.27-83.72 percent,
FARM MACHINERY TESTING AND TRAINING CENTRE
ALL INDIA COORDINATED RESEARCH PROJECT ON FARM IMPLEMENTS AND MACHINERY
‘De ANNASAHEB SHINDE COLLEGE OF AGRICULTURAL ENGINEERING AND TECHNOLOGY,
MAHATMA PHULE KRISH! VIDY APEETH, RAHURI, DIST. AHMEDNAGAR $13 722[Link] ‘An
[Link]./217/ 2019
‘9 Tyne u-clamp Cultivator
2
(Tractor Mounted) [Commercial] racenns
6.3 Power requirement: The draft req sment was recorded as 330-345 kgf and the power
requirement was calculated as 4.57 ~ 5.09 Hp.

7. DEFECTS, BREAKDOWNS AND REPAIRS
No breakdowns were observed during the course of operation,
8. SUMM. F OBSERVATIONS,
8.1 The dimension of shovel not fully conforms to IS: 3342-1998. It should be looked into
at regular production level.
8.2. The hardness of shovel and sweep were recorded as 299.17 HB and 117 HB
respectively against the requirement of 350 ~ 450 HB this should be looked in to.

8.3. Some dimensions of three point linkage does not conforms to the dimensions as given
IS: 4468 (Part 1): 1997 for eat. 1 /eat. 2. These may be fabricated as per relevant IS
standard at regular production level.
‘The field performance of the implement was satisfactory.
The rate of work was recorded as 0.554 - 0,629 hh at the forward speed of
3.68 — 4.021 kmph.
The depth of operation was recorded as 12.76 ~ 14.38 em and width of operation was
recorded as 195.4-197.4 em which is considered normal for such operations.
The hourly percentage wear of shovels on mass were 0.066 to 0.098 percent. The
hourly rate of wear of shovels is considered normal.
Overall performance of the implement was found satisfactory.
